As other reviewers have said, very tight, very dark, not dry.
Which is what makes the entire experience so cool. Extremely underrated activity for Corner Brook, took me months of living here before hearing about it and doing it myself. I've gone twice, once with a guide and once without (would probably not recommend doing it without a guide on your first attempt - it is a maze).
There are several entrances/exits to the cave system but even more dead ends.
I have yet to complete the journey start to finish without getting up to my armpits in water - but temperature wasn't a problem, just dress accordingly.
Unless you're a professional spelunker, you probably haven't done anything like this, and I can't understate how great it is - for the non-claustrophobic.
